Poland can boost their slim hopes of a Nations League quarterfinal place with a win against Croatia in this key Group A1 clash in Warsaw.
The Poles currently find themselves in third in the table behind Croatia following the host's disappointing 1-3 home defeat to runaway group leaders Portugal on Saturday.
Croatia claimed a tight 2-1 home win over Scotland at the weekend, with a win here potentially drawing them level at the top with the Portuguese.
Poland host Croatia at the Kazimierz Górski National Stadium in Warsaw on Tuesday, Oct. 15. Kickoff is set for 8:45 p.m. CEST local time in Poland. That makes it a 7:45 p.m. BST start in the UK, which is 2:45 p.m. ET or 11:45 a.m. PT in the US and Canada, and 5:45 a.m. AEDT on Wednesday, Oct. 16 in Australia.
